Sunnhordland Archipelago RIB Speedboat Safari

Blast through the skerries and sea-lanes of the Sunnhordland archipelago aboard a high-speed RIB, spotting seabirds, seals, and the wild coastline that cruise ships can only admire from afar. Small-group intensity, big-fjord scale.

What to expect

Kitted out in a warm survival suit, you roar out of Leirvik harbour and into the open archipelago, weaving between granite islets polished smooth by the last Ice Age. Your skipper-guide cuts the engine in sheltered coves to let you watch grey seals haul out on sun-warmed rocks and scan the sky for white-tailed sea eagles. The RIB also noses into dramatic sea caves carved by Atlantic swells, and the return sprint across open water — spray flying, islands streaking past — is pure adrenaline. Back at the pier within 2–3 hours, exhilarated and fully dry thanks to the suit.

Good to know

Suits, life jackets, and gloves provided. Minimum age typically 8–10 yrs. Book as a private charter for maximum flexibility and to guarantee departure aligned with your all-aboard time. Seas can be choppy — confirm conditions morning of.
